Zoo Thoiry is a wildlife park and safari zoo located in Thoiry, France, about 40 km west of Paris. It spans over 370 acres and houses more than 1,500 animals. Known for its drive-through safari and glass tunnels, the zoo emphasizes conservation, education, and immersive wildlife experiences.
Navigate from the drive-through Safari Zone to the Lemur Island walk and the glass tunnel under the lions. Don’t miss the Adventure Trail with rope bridges and slides that kids can’t get enough of.
The map also helps you find La Serre Tropicale, snack bars like Le Baroudeur, and even the viewing dome inside the hyena habitat.

Where is Thoiry ZooSafari located, and how can I get there?
Thoiry ZooSafari is located at Rue du Pavillon de Montreuil, 78770 Thoiry, in the Yvelines department, about 35–45 minutes west of Paris by car. You can reach the zoo by car via the N12 or A13 motorways, or by taking the Transilien train (Line N) from Paris Montparnasse to Montfort-l’Amaury – Méré station, followed by a shuttle bus to the park. Free parking is available on site for visitors arriving by car.
What are the opening hours of Thoiry Zoo Safari?
Thoiry ZooSafari is generally open daily from 10:00 am, with closing times varying by season: 5:00 pm–5:30 pm from January to June and September to December, and 6:30 pm–7:00 pm in July and August. During special events like the “Wild Lights” festival, the park may stay open until 8:00 pm. The zoo is closed on December 25 and may have limited hours on certain holidays, so checking the official website before visiting is recommended.
How much do tickets cost for Thoiry Zoo Safari?
Ticket prices for Thoiry ZooSafari are €34 for adults (ages 12 and up) and €25 for children (ages 3–11), with free entry for children under 3. Reduced rates are available for seniors and people with disabilities, and additional activities like the bush truck safari or zipline require a supplementary fee. Tickets include access to the safari, zoo, gardens, and castle, and can be purchased online or at the entrance.
What can I expect from the safari experience at Thoiry Zoo Safari?
At Thoiry ZooSafari, visitors can drive their own car or ride a bush truck through an 8 km safari trail to see animals like giraffes, zebras, elephants, lions, and bears roaming freely. The park also features a traditional zoo with immersive areas, playgrounds, gardens, and a historic château, making it an engaging and educational day out for all ages. The experience combines close-up wildlife encounters with family-friendly activities, picnic areas, and seasonal events.
